HDL Coder入门使用指南压缩包内容概览

版权申诉
0 下载量 155 浏览量 更新于2024-11-01 收藏 6.57MB ZIP 举报
资源摘要信息:"HDL coder是Xilinx公司推出的一款高级综合工具,用于将MATLAB/Simulink模型转换为硬件描述语言(HDL),如VHDL或Verilog。该工具主要用于FPGA(现场可编程门阵列)和ASIC(应用特定集成电路)的设计过程中。用户可以利用HDL coder生成的代码在硬件上实现复杂的算法和控制逻辑。 HDL coder的get started guide,即入门指南,为初学者提供了一个全面的指导资源。这份指南通常包含如下几个方面的知识内容: 1. HDL coder的基本介绍:涵盖了HDL coder的定义、工作原理、应用场景以及它在硬件设计中所扮演的角色。用户将了解HDL coder如何将抽象的算法模型转换为具体的硬件实现。 2. 安装和配置:详细指导用户如何在自己的计算机上安装HDL coder,以及如何进行配置,包括设置MATLAB和Simulink环境以兼容HDL coder。 3. 使用Simulink进行建模:介绍如何使用Simulink建立模型,这是HDL coder处理的主要输入。包括信号和系统的基本建模方法,以及如何添加必要的参数和属性。 4. 代码生成过程:深入解释HDL coder的代码生成机制,例如如何处理算法中的循环、条件判断、函数调用等,以及如何优化生成的HDL代码以符合特定的硬件要求。 5. 验证和测试:讲解如何验证和测试通过HDL coder生成的代码。这包括在MATLAB/Simulink环境中进行功能仿真,以及在FPGA或ASIC硬件上进行硬件验证。 6. 高级主题:提供了对HDL coder高级特性的介绍,比如使用HDL Workflow Advisor来优化工作流程,以及针对特定硬件平台的优化技巧。 7. 故障排除:分享一些常见的问题及其解决方法,帮助用户在遇到问题时能够快速定位和解决问题。 8. 案例研究:通常会包含一个或多个实际案例研究,让用户在实践中学习如何使用HDL coder将MATLAB/Simulink模型转换为有效的HDL代码。 该指南对于初学者而言是一份宝贵的资料,它不仅涉及到理论知识,还提供了实际操作的步骤和技巧,帮助用户逐步掌握使用HDL coder的技能。对于设计工程师来说,这份指南是快速入门并提升工作效率的重要工具。 需要注意的是,提供的文件名「赚钱项目」似乎与HDL coder的入门指南并无直接关联,这可能意味着该压缩包文件实际上并未包含关于HDL coder的任何资料,而是包含了另一个与「赚钱项目」相关的内容。如果这是一个错误,请核实文件的实际内容以确保提供的信息准确无误。" 由于文件的实际内容无法直接获取,此处的内容仅供参考,具体的知识点还需根据实际的文档内容进行详细解读。